Rear End

Hello all;

Will a 99 ford f250 rear end 9' with disc brakes fit in the 1992 F250?

Mine,
C5 4.10. 6250 FORD LIMITED SLIP Full Floating

Thanks in advance.

I think the spring perches are a different width, so I doubt it would be a direct bolt in.

The other issue is that the wheel bolt pattern is different, so you would have to use wheels from a 99+ truck on the rear, while keeping the older wheels on the front.

If you want disc brakes, you might look for an axle from a newer E-350 van. Those will have disc brakes and have the same bolt pattern as you have now.

The super duty/f250 rear ends are 10.5"

9" rears came in older vans, small trucks, and some cars I believe.

I can't comment on the bolt pattern. It looks and "feels" the same as the older f250's but like mentioned I have also seen people mention the super duties have a metric pattern now. Up to 1997, F-250 and 350 used a 8x6.5" bolt pattern, 1999 and up have 8x170mm bolt pattern. They are not interchangeable.

Those bolt patterns are close, but definitely NOT close enough to be compatible!

Also, if your existing truck has drum brakes, you would have to re-engineer the hydraulics for the brakes as well. Disks need a LOT more pressure than drums, so the existing proportioning valve needs to be replaced with one for a disk. And since there would be no ABS, getting the proper balance is not a simple task....
